3 star hotels in Gloucestershire
199 results found
- Most popular first Sorting
Woodmill Farm Apartment
Woodmill Farm Lower Common, Alvington, United Kingdom (Open map)
The Albert Hotel
56-58 Worcester St, GLOUCESTERSHIRE, United Kingdom (Open map)
Greensleeves
40 Wallscourt Road South Apartment 3, 2Nd Floor, Filton, United Kingdom (Open map)
Maugersbury Park Suite
12 Maugersbury Park Stow On The Wold, Stow-on-the-Wold, United Kingdom (Open map)
Rounceval House
64 Rounceval Street, Chipping Sodbury, United Kingdom (Open map)
The Miners Sling
Chepstow Road, Clearwell, United Kingdom (Open map)
Cotswold Garden Tea Rooms
Wells Cottage, Digbeth Street, Stow-on-the-Wold, United Kingdom (Open map)
Pittville Central Parking Modern Wifi
3, Pittville Crescent Lane, Cheltenham, United Kingdom (Open map)
Dove Court Travel Lodge 3 - First Floor Ensuite
Dove Court Travel Lodge, 217 Gloucester Road, Almondsbury, United Kingdom (Open map)
Dove Court Travel Lodge 5 - First Floor Ensuite
Dove Court Travel Lodge, 217 Gloucester Road, Almondsbury, United Kingdom (Open map)
Magnolia Self Contained Suites
1 Rathbone Close, Coalpit Heath, Coalpit Heath, United Kingdom (Open map)
Town Centre Luxury In 21A, 21B And 21C Montpellier Terrace Available Separately Or Together, Amazing Location Opposite Montpellier Gardens
21 Montpellier Terrace - Luxury Short Stays, Cheltenham, United Kingdom (Open map)
Dove Court Travel Lodge 2 - First Floor Ensuite
Dove Court Travel Lodge, 217 Gloucester Road, Almondsbury, United Kingdom (Open map)
Dove Court Travel Lodge 1 - Ground Floor Ensuite
Dove Court Travel Lodge, 217 Gloucester Road, Almondsbury, United Kingdom (Open map)
Belvedere House Bed And Breakfast
Belvedere, Lower Lydbrook, Lydbrook, United Kingdom (Open map)
Willow Court Lodge
209 Gloucester Road, Almondsbury, United Kingdom (Open map)
Alveston House Hotel
David S Lane, Alveston (Gloucestershire), United Kingdom (Open map)
Eagle Lodge Rooms
Montpellier Drive, Cheltenham, United Kingdom (Open map)
Premier Inn Premier Inn Gloucester
Witcombe--Gloucester, Gloucester, United Kingdom (Open map)